Output 5a1010ceae003eb82a75df823bd0148ef9a567e509a080f80ef96550ac349112:2

value
15643602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400fe52023bb7ebd87ec1e39025b3bd9d37bac22 OP_EQUAL
address
MDjtX7ViZnbSNcxEyhUUQq1GwQtes5LwXT
transaction
5a1010ceae003eb82a75df823bd0148ef9a567e509a080f80ef96550ac349112
spent
true